Verdict

INCENTIVE has a good record fresh having won first time out last year and finished third on her first start back in 2018 and she is taken to return to winning ways with a victory in this competitive looking 7f handicap. The selection is back down to her last winning mark following some moderate efforts last autumn and she can take this at the chief expense of Gavi Di Gavi who should appreciate the return to this distance having disappointed over further on his final start of last year. Third place can go the way of Fieldsman who is well drawn here and has won off higher marks in the past.
